What is the Sunderkand?
The Sunderkand (literally “beautiful canto”) is the fifth book of the Ramcharitmanas, composed by Tulsidas. An English PDF version makes this profound text available to a broader audience. It uniquely focuses solely on Hanuman, detailing his incredible feats and unwavering devotion to Lord Rama.
Unlike other sections of the Ramcharitmanas, the Sunderkand doesn’t directly advance the main narrative of Rama’s search for Sita. Instead, it serves as a powerful, independent narrative celebrating Hanuman’s strength, intelligence, and selfless service.
A PDF allows for easy navigation through its numerous chapters, recounting Hanuman’s flight to Lanka, his exploration of Ravana’s kingdom, and his eventual meeting with Sita.

The Significance of Hanuman in the Sunderkand
Hanuman is the central figure of the Sunderkand, embodying unparalleled devotion, courage, and selfless service. An English PDF allows deeper exploration of his character and virtues. He represents the ideal bhakta (devotee), demonstrating unwavering faith and complete surrender to Lord Rama.
The Sunderkand highlights Hanuman’s extraordinary abilities – his strength to leap across the ocean, his intelligence in navigating Lanka, and his humility despite possessing immense power. These qualities are inspiring and serve as a model for spiritual aspirants.
A downloadable PDF provides convenient access to stories illustrating Hanuman’s unwavering loyalty and his role as Rama’s emissary. His encounters with various beings in Lanka showcase his diplomatic skills and righteous conduct.

Chapter 1: Hanuman’s Journey to Lanka
This initial chapter within the Sunderkand PDF meticulously chronicles Hanuman’s arduous voyage from Kishkindha to Lanka. It details his departure, empowered by Rama’s blessings and the guidance of Sugriva. The narrative vividly portrays Hanuman’s incredible aerial journey, overcoming geographical obstacles like the vast ocean, described with poetic detail.
The PDF often highlights Hanuman’s encounters during his flight – Surasa, the serpent goddess, and Simhika, the Rakshasi. These trials test Hanuman’s devotion and power, showcasing his unwavering commitment to Rama’s mission. The chapter emphasizes Hanuman’s strategic approach, utilizing his intellect and divine abilities to navigate these challenges.

Chapter 2: Hanuman Meets Sita
This profoundly moving chapter, readily accessible within the Sunderkand English PDF, details Hanuman’s first encounter with Sita in the Ashoka Vatika. The PDF emphasizes Hanuman’s initial cautious approach, observing Sita from a distance to assess her condition and confirm her identity as Rama’s wife.
The narrative beautifully portrays Sita’s plight – her loneliness, unwavering devotion to Rama, and the suffering endured under Ravana’s captivity. Hanuman, demonstrating utmost humility and respect, reveals his true identity as Rama’s messenger, offering her Rama’s ring as proof of his well-being.
The English translation within the PDF clarifies the emotional depth of their conversation, highlighting Sita’s initial skepticism and eventual acceptance of Hanuman’s divine mission.
